How Our Crawl Space Water Extraction Process Works
When you call us for crawl space water extraction, you’re not just getting a repair service, you’re getting a team of experts who will work tirelessly to restore your home to its former glory.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and stress-free. We’ll assess the damage, extract the water, dry the area, and ensure everything is safe and secure.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send our trained technicians to assess the damage and create a customized plan to tackle the issue. This may involve specialized equipment like our truck-mounted extractors or portable pumps.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our advanced equipment, we’ll extract the standing water from your crawl space, making sure to remove every last drop.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the area thoroughly.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and ensuring your home remains safe and secure.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ize the area, removing any remaining debris or contaminants. This ensures your home is safe and healthy for you and your family.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Once the area is dry and clean, we’ll assess any necessary repairs or replacements. This may involve fixing damaged insulation, replacing wet drywall, or addressing other structural issues.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Conover, NC
The cost of crawl space water extraction in Conover, NC, varies dep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500, but this can vary depending on the specifics of your situ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| The amount of water extracted and the complexity of the issue.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$100 – $500 | The extent of the cleaning and sanitizing required. |
| Restoration and Repair | $500 – $2,500 | The extent of the repairs and replacements needed. |
| Equipment Rental and Labor | $100 – $500 | The type and duration of equipment rental and labor required. |
